Comprehending Conservatory Leaks
Before delving into options, it's important to understand what triggers leaks in conservatories. Typical culprits include:
Poor Installation: Inadequate sealing, incorrect fitting of roof panels, and substandard workmanship can result in water ingress.Use and Tear: Over time, seals and gaskets can break down, allowing water to permeate through.Ecological Factors: Extreme weather, such as heavy rain and strong winds, can worsen existing issues.Roof Design: Flat or inadequately sloped roofing systems are more prone to water accumulation and subsequent leaks.Rain Gutter and Downspout Issues: Clogged gutters and downspouts can cause water to support and permeate into the conservatory.Determining the Source of the Leak

Once you've recognized the source of the leak, you can take the following steps to fix it:

Seal Gaps and Cracks:
Silicone Sealant: Apply a high-quality silicone sealant to any spaces or cracks. Guarantee the surface is clean and dry before application.Epoxy Resin: For larger fractures, use an epoxy resin for a more durable fix.
Replace Damaged Components:
Roof Panels: If the roof panels are damaged, replace them with new ones. Guarantee they are correctly sealed and fitted.Seals and Gaskets: Replace any used or damaged seals and gaskets. Use top quality materials to ensure longevity.
Reinforce Roof Fixings:
Tighten Screws and Bolts: Tighten any loose screws or bolts. If needed, change them with brand-new, top quality fasteners.Usage Sealant: Apply a sealant around the heads of screws and bolts to avoid water from leaking through.
Improve Roof Slope:
Regrade the Roof: If the roof is flat or improperly sloped, consider regrading it to improve water overflow.Install a Pitched Roof: For a more permanent solution, think about setting up a pitched roof, which is less prone to water build-up.
Keep Gutters and Downspouts:
Regular Cleaning: Clean seamless gutters and downspouts frequently to prevent blockages.Set Up Gutter Guards: Consider installing seamless gutter guards to minimize the threat of clogs.Professional Help
